Hey everyone! I wasn't exactly sure where to put this thread, but it's pretty much a giant toy so I figured this was the place! We just finished this guy up in our workshop a few days ago. We got inspired one day by the classic Aurora monsters in cars models and started talking about how cool it would be to have one of those but with a life size monster in a tiny car and then make the whole thing radio controlled! So we started looking up cool looking kids electric ride on toy cars and hot-rodded it out a bit, then fabricated a custom Ed Roth inspired Nosferatu to drive it! I sculpted the head and hands and then cast the head in latex stretched over a lexan shell and cast the hands in resin. The body is lightweight solid cast foam with flexible joints. As he drives, the headlights and tail lights light up, and as you steer him we made his head look left and right. His top speed is about 3 or 4 mph and he stands about 3.5' tall and 4' long.
